FHA Special Forbearance: If you are having difficulty making mortgage payments because you are unemployed and have no other sources of income, you may be eligible for FHA’s Special Forbearance. FHA now requires servicers to extend the forbearance period, by offering a reduced or suspended mortgage payment for up to twelve months, for FHA.

The Federal Housing Administartion has set mortgage insurance factors with Up Front Mortgage Insurance of 1.75% of your base loan amount plus the annual mortgage insurance (Paid Monthly).

Fha Qualifying Ratios Mip Rates For Fha Loans Get Approved for a Home Loan. Mortgage Insurance Premiums. An FHA loan will require a mortgage insurance premium regardless of your down payment. The FHA mip rate will depend on the amount you put down and the amount of the loan. upfront fha mip. fha also has an upfront mip fee of 1.75% of the loan amount that is included in the closing costs.The Federal Housing Administration, which insures loans for borrowers of modest means, offers relatively flexible guidelines. The maximum qualifying ratios depend on your overall financial picture and the presence of compensating factors.

FHA loans are mortgages insured by the Federal Housing Administration, the largest mortgage insurers in the world. The FHA was established in 1934 after The Great Depression and its continuing mission is to create more homeowners in the US.

FHA mortgages have always been the alternative to risky subprime mortgages. The underwriting guidelines for FHA mortgages are very flexible and as a result when your personal loan officer takes your applications and tries to approve it they will receive a response from their underwriting system on if you are Approved, Approved with Conditions, or Not approved.

An FHA loan is a mortgage that’s insured by the Federal Housing Administration (FHA). They are popular especially among first time home buyers because they allow down payments of 3.5% for credit scores of 580+. However, borrowers must pay mortgage insurance premiums, which protects the lender if a borrower defaults.
